2016-07-05 16:23:25 +02:00
Akka
====
2015-04-16 22:10:32 +02:00
2016-07-05 16:23:25 +02:00
We believe that writing correct concurrent & distributed, resilient and elastic applications is too hard.
Most of the time it's because we are using the wrong tools and the wrong level of abstraction.
2015-04-16 22:10:32 +02:00
Akka is here to change that.
2016-03-09 22:09:45 +01:00
Using the Actor Model we raise the abstraction level and provide a better platform to build correct concurrent and scalable applications. This model is a perfect match for the principles laid out in the [Reactive Manifesto ](http://www.reactivemanifesto.org/ ).
2015-04-16 22:10:32 +02:00
For resilience we adopt the "Let it crash" model which the telecom industry has used with great success to build applications that self-heal and systems that never stop.
Actors also provide the abstraction for transparent distribution and the basis for truly scalable and fault-tolerant applications.
2016-07-05 16:23:25 +02:00
Learn more at [akka.io ](http://akka.io/ ).
Reference Documentation
-----------------------
The reference documentation is available at [doc.akka.io ](http://doc.akka.io ),
2016-07-11 11:59:39 +02:00
for [Scala ](http://doc.akka.io/docs/akka/current/scala.html ) and [Java ](http://doc.akka.io/docs/akka/current/java.html ).
2016-07-05 16:23:25 +02:00
Community
---------
You can join these groups and chats to discuss and ask Akka related questions:
- Mailing list: [](https://groups.google.com/forum/#!forum/akka-user)
- Chat room about *using* Akka: [](https://gitter.im/akka/akka)
- Issue tracker: [](https://github.com/akka/akka/issues)
In addition to that, you may enjoy following:
2015-04-16 22:10:32 +02:00
2016-07-11 12:00:42 +02:00
- The [news ](http://akka.io/news ) section of the page, which is updated whenever a new version is released
2016-07-05 16:23:25 +02:00
- The [Akka Team Blog ](http://blog.akka.io )
- [@akkateam ](https://twitter.com/akkateam ) on Twitter
2016-07-08 12:36:33 -04:00
- Questions tagged [#akka on StackOverflow ](http://stackoverflow.com/questions/tagged/akka )
2015-04-16 22:10:32 +02:00
2016-07-05 16:23:25 +02:00
Contributing
------------
Contributions are *very* welcome!
2015-12-29 14:36:44 +01:00
2016-07-05 16:23:25 +02:00
If you see an issue that you'd like to see fixed, the best way to make it happen is to help out by submitting a PullRequest implementing it.
Refer to the [CONTRIBUTING.md ](https://github.com/akka/akka/blob/master/CONTRIBUTING.md ) file for more details about the workflow,
2016-07-18 03:33:44 -05:00
and general hints how to prepare your pull request. You can also chat ask for clarifications or guidance in GitHub issues directly,
2016-07-05 16:23:25 +02:00
or in the akka/dev chat if a more real time communication would be of benefit.
A chat room is available for all questions related to *developing and contributing* to Akka:
[](https://gitter.im/akka/dev)
License
-------
Akka is Open Source and available under the Apache 2 License.